Output ddae63564af7e90ef0f6cd5306f63935ae09d8498d4ed6de6026542ee796d1e3:12

value
365579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b97698e31c18be16c42ff3d72257bfa00427cdf6 OP_EQUAL
address
3Jbf1K1hoJLwepXJvc2zytMTESNt4gRTfp
transaction
ddae63564af7e90ef0f6cd5306f63935ae09d8498d4ed6de6026542ee796d1e3
confirmations
324665
spent
true